Transaction 4eab7e3489869d1afe50013842fa79c6e59e92aba94ae4032414eaa71bc24f44
1 Input
2 Outputs
- 4eab7e3489869d1afe50013842fa79c6e59e92aba94ae4032414eaa71bc24f44:0
- 4eab7e3489869d1afe50013842fa79c6e59e92aba94ae4032414eaa71bc24f44:1
value 1289113
address 14HBSQajsRQfvpmW2u5aKEWT1vQaQejfQ1
value 10000
address 38uYndMai8gnUwZNGBaMgnjeVke2qwVDsG